#a570d5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a570d5 is composed of 64.7% red, 43.9%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.5% cyan, 47.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 271.5 degrees, a saturation of 54.6% and a lightness of 63.7%. #a570d5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e0ff with #4b00ab.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

Shades and Tints of #a570d5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060309 is the darkest color, while #fbf8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#a570d5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a3a2a3 is the less saturated color, while #a74cf9 is the most saturated one.
